About a year ago I bought my Volkswagen not long thereafter I decided I hated German engineering. I have had so many excessive problems with this car and the dealer that insists I get it maintained and fixed by them (I hate them so much I have sworn off ever talking to a dealership again). I did a lot of researching as to what my next car would be. I wasn't in a rush since my vw cc was operational and reliable enough for the next couple years at least. I love having a project to work on (I've built and sold a few custom carborated bikes) and so I didn't care to much on having a car that sat for a few years. I also wanted it to be older say 80's or 90's to avoid the more complex cars that I'm not super used to working on. In my research I decided on a few things listed as 1) I wanted an inline six for its stability, larger space under the hood for a bi turbo system, and more power potential than an inline 4 (or box 4 for that matter). 2) I wanted awd because the roads in Utah are spooky sometimes. 3) I wanted a rare car that wasn't flashy unless you knew what you were looking at. 4) I wanted the car to be common enough that it would be easy to find after-market and performance upgrades. 5) I wanted the car to have a cult following (optional). The first car I came across was a (German) 1988 BMW 325ix. I loved the idea so much I didn't even get bothered by the fact that it was German or that it was genuinely going to be hard to find one for sale. I stopped my research there and threw my motorcycle mechanic books into the oceans (good place for greasy books) and bought a book for every part of this car. I'm invested. I have seen a few cars come up for sale and sadly have not been able to jump on one because my apartment complex has "rules". So the only thing holding me back right now is the fact that I have to buy a house like and adult. I'm about there and will probably have a house in September. Then I will immediately look to buy a 325ix. Let me know what you guys think. What should I focus this car towards? I want it to be daily driver compatible...but like...also a competitor on the track. AWD makes me want to focus the build more towards gravel or snow rally. Any input? Suggestions? Is a reasonable hp goal around 400? Reading material? Other forums that are more specific towards race car builds? Thanks for reading this novel.
